#!/usr/bin/env python3
# Copyright (c) Meta Platforms, Inc. and affiliates.
#
# This source code is licensed under the MIT license found in the
# LICENSE file in the root directory of this source tree.

# pyre-strict

import abc
import re
from enum import Enum
from typing import List

from fbpcp.entity.file_information import FileInfo
from fbpcp.entity.policy_statement import PolicyStatement, PublicAccessBlockConfig


class PathType(Enum):
Local = 1
S3 = 2
GCS = 3


class StorageService(abc.ABC):
@abc.abstractmethod
def read(self, filename: str) -> str:
pass

@abc.abstractmethod
def write(self, filename: str, data: str) -> None:
pass

@abc.abstractmethod
def copy(self, source: str, destination: str) -> None:
pass

@abc.abstractmethod
def file_exists(self, filename: str) -> bool:
pass

@staticmethod
def path_type(filename: str) -> PathType:
s3_match = re.search(
"^https?:/([^.]+).s3.([^.]+).amazonaws.com/(.*)$", filename
)
if s3_match:
return PathType.S3

gcs_match = re.search("^https?://storage.cloud.google.com/(.*)$", filename)
if gcs_match:
return PathType.GCS

return PathType.Local

@abc.abstractmethod
def get_file_size(self, filename: str) -> int:
pass

@abc.abstractmethod
def get_file_info(self, filename: str) -> FileInfo:
pass

@abc.abstractmethod
def list_folders(self, filename: str) -> List[str]:
pass

@abc.abstractmethod
def get_bucket_policy_statements(self, bucket: str) -> List[PolicyStatement]:
pass

@abc.abstractmethod
def get_bucket_public_access_block(self, bucket: str) -> PublicAccessBlockConfig:
pass

@abc.abstractmethod
def list_files(self, dirPath: str) -> List[str]:
pass

#!/usr/bin/env python3
# Copyright (c) Meta Platforms, Inc. and affiliates.
#
# This source code is licensed under the MIT license found in the
# LICENSE file in the root directory of this source tree.

# pyre-strict

import os
from os import path
from os.path import join, normpath, relpath
from typing import Any, Dict, List, Optional

from fbpcp.entity.file_information import FileInfo
from fbpcp.entity.policy_statement import PolicyStatement, PublicAccessBlockConfig
from fbpcp.gateway.s3 import S3Gateway
from fbpcp.util.s3path import S3Path
from onedocker.service.storage import PathType, StorageService


class S3StorageService(StorageService):
def __init__(
self,
region: str = "us-west-1",
access_key_id: Optional[str] = None,
access_key_data: Optional[str] = None,
config: Optional[Dict[str, Any]] = None,
session_token: Optional[str] = None,
) -> None:
self.s3_gateway = S3Gateway(
region, access_key_id, access_key_data, config, session_token
)

def read(self, filename: str) -> str:
"""Read a file data
Keyword arguments:
filename -- "https://bucket-name.s3.Region.amazonaws.com/key-name"
"""
s3_path = S3Path(filename)
return self.s3_gateway.get_object(s3_path.bucket, s3_path.key)

def write(self, filename: str, data: str) -> None:
"""Write data into a file
Keyword arguments:
filename -- "https://bucket-name.s3.Region.amazonaws.com/key-name"`
"""
s3_path = S3Path(filename)
self.s3_gateway.put_object(s3_path.bucket, s3_path.key, data)

def copy(self, source: str, destination: str, recursive: bool = False) -> None:
"""Move a file or folder between local storage and S3, as well as, S3 and S3
Keyword arguments:
source -- source file
destination -- destination file
recursive -- whether to recursively copy a folder
"""
if StorageService.path_type(source) == PathType.Local:
# from local to S3
if StorageService.path_type(destination) == PathType.Local:
raise ValueError("Both source and destination are local files")
s3_path = S3Path(destination)
if path.isdir(source):
if not recursive:
raise ValueError(f"Source {source} is a folder. Use --recursive")
self.upload_dir(source, s3_path.bucket, s3_path.key)
else:
self.s3_gateway.upload_file(source, s3_path.bucket, s3_path.key)
else:
source_s3_path = S3Path(source)
if StorageService.path_type(destination) == PathType.S3:
# from S3 to S3
dest_s3_path = S3Path(destination)
if source_s3_path == dest_s3_path:
raise ValueError(
f"Source {source} and destination {destination} are the same"
)

if source.endswith("/"):
if not recursive:
raise ValueError(
f"Source {source} is a folder. Use --recursive"
)

self.copy_dir(
source_s3_path.bucket,
source_s3_path.key + "/",
dest_s3_path.bucket,
dest_s3_path.key,
)
else:
self.s3_gateway.copy(
source_s3_path.bucket,
source_s3_path.key,
dest_s3_path.bucket,
dest_s3_path.key,
)
else:
# from S3 to local
if source.endswith("/"):
if not recursive:
raise ValueError(
f"Source {source} is a folder. Use --recursive"
)
self.download_dir(
source_s3_path.bucket,
source_s3_path.key + "/",
destination,
)
else:
self.s3_gateway.download_file(
source_s3_path.bucket, source_s3_path.key, destination
)

def upload_dir(self, source: str, s3_path_bucket: str, s3_path_key: str) -> None:
for root, dirs, files in os.walk(source):
for file in files:
local_path = join(root, file)
destination_path = s3_path_key + "/" + relpath(local_path, source)

self.s3_gateway.upload_file(
local_path,
s3_path_bucket,
destination_path,
)
for dir in dirs:
local_path = join(root, dir)
destination_path = s3_path_key + "/" + relpath(local_path, source)

self.s3_gateway.put_object(
s3_path_bucket,
destination_path + "/",
"",
)

def download_dir(
self, s3_path_bucket: str, s3_path_key: str, destination: str
) -> None:
if not self.s3_gateway.object_exists(s3_path_bucket, s3_path_key):
raise ValueError(
f"Key {s3_path_key} does not exist in bucket {s3_path_bucket}"
)
keys = self.s3_gateway.list_object2(s3_path_bucket, s3_path_key)
for key in keys:
local_path = normpath(destination + "/" + key[len(s3_path_key) :])
if key.endswith("/"):
if not path.exists(local_path):
os.makedirs(local_path)
else:
self.s3_gateway.download_file(s3_path_bucket, key, local_path)

def copy_dir(
self,
source_bucket: str,
source_key: str,
destination_bucket: str,
destination_key: str,
) -> None:
if not self.s3_gateway.object_exists(source_bucket, source_key):
raise ValueError(
f"Key {source_key} does not exist in bucket {source_bucket}"
)
keys = self.s3_gateway.list_object2(source_bucket, source_key)
for key in keys:
destination_path = destination_key + "/" + key[len(source_key) :]
if key.endswith("/"):
self.s3_gateway.put_object(
source_bucket,
destination_path,
"",
)
else:
self.s3_gateway.copy(
source_bucket,
key,
destination_bucket,
destination_path,
)

def delete(self, filename: str) -> None:
"""Delete an s3 file
Keyword arguments:
filename -- the s3 file to be deleted
"""
if StorageService.path_type(filename) == PathType.S3:
s3_path = S3Path(filename)
self.s3_gateway.delete_object(s3_path.bucket, s3_path.key)
else:
raise ValueError("The file is not an s3 file")

def file_exists(self, filename: str) -> bool:
if StorageService.path_type(filename) == PathType.S3:
s3_path = S3Path(filename)
return self.s3_gateway.object_exists(s3_path.bucket, s3_path.key)
else:
raise ValueError(f"File {filename} is not an S3 filepath")

def get_file_info(self, filename: str) -> FileInfo:
"""Show file information (last modified time, type and size)
Keyword arguments:
filename -- the s3 file to be shown
"""
s3_path = S3Path(filename)
file_info_dict = self.s3_gateway.get_object_info(s3_path.bucket, s3_path.key)
return FileInfo(
file_name=filename,
last_modified=file_info_dict.get("LastModified").ctime(),
file_size=file_info_dict.get("ContentLength"),
)

def get_file_size(self, filename: str) -> int:
s3_path = S3Path(filename)
return self.s3_gateway.get_object_size(s3_path.bucket, s3_path.key)

def list_folders(self, filename: str) -> List[str]:
s3_path = S3Path(filename)
return self.s3_gateway.list_folders(s3_path.bucket, s3_path.key)

def get_bucket_policy_statements(self, bucket: str) -> List[PolicyStatement]:
return self.s3_gateway.get_policy_statements(bucket)

def get_bucket_public_access_block(self, bucket: str) -> PublicAccessBlockConfig:
return self.s3_gateway.get_public_access_block(bucket)

def list_files(self, dirPath: str) -> List[str]:
"""Returns all paths of files in folders and sub folders recursively
Keyword arguments:
dirPath -- s3 dir path
"""
s3_path = S3Path(dirPath)
return self.s3_gateway.list_object2(s3_path.bucket, s3_path.key)
